Searching for Ge neutrinoless double beta decay with the CDEX-1B experiment

arXiv:2305.00894 · doi:10.1088/1674-1137/ad597b

Abstract

We operated a p-type point contact high purity germanium (PPCGe) detector (CDEX-1B, 1.008 kg) in the China Jinping Underground Laboratory (CJPL) for 500.3 days to search for neutrinoless double beta () decay of Ge. A total of 504.3 kgday effective exposure data was accumulated. The anti-coincidence and the multi/single-site event (MSE/SSE) discrimination methods were used to suppress the background in the energy region of interest (ROI, 19892089 keV for this work) with a factor of 23. A background level of 0.33 counts/(keVkgyr) was realized. The lower limit on the half life of Ge decay was constrained as , corresponding to the upper limits on the effective Majorana neutrino mass: 3.27.5.
